Jennifer Andreas speaks about promising biological control for flowering rush
Jennifer Andreas of Washington State Extension created a presentation as part of the Upper Midwest Invasive Species Conference last spring that focused on flowering rush and possible biocontrol for this invasive species. These biocontrol measures, a fly, a weevil and a white smut, are still being studied to ensure they have no ill effects on non-target species, but they seem promising.
